Firefighters Tackle Blaze in Central Wellington Apartment Block

Firefighters have successfully extinguished a blaze in a central Wellington apartment block. Police and fire crews responded swiftly to the emergency, blocking off the surrounding street.

The fire broke out in the apartment complex, prompting immediate action from local emergency services. Firefighters worked diligently to control the situation and ensure the safety of nearby residents. Law enforcement supported the efforts by managing traffic and securing the area.

No injuries have been reported, and residents were evacuated safely. Fire crews remain on site to monitor for any flare-ups and assess the damage.
